An tsara na'urori masu kariya daga AC don kare kariya daga yanayin hauhawar ɗan lokaci. Manyan al'amura da suka taso kamar guda, kamar walƙiya, na iya isa ga dubban dubunnan volts kuma suna iya haifar da gazawar kayan aiki kai tsaye ko na tsaka-tsalle. Koyaya, rashin walƙiya da ƙarancin ikon amfani kawai suna da kashi 20% na saurin wucewa. Sauran 80% na aikin karuwa an samar da shi a ciki. Kodayake waɗannan haɓaka suna iya zama karami a girma, suna faruwa sau da yawa kuma tare da ci gaba da ɗaukar hoto na iya lalata kayan aikin lantarki masu mahimmanci a cikin kayan aikin.
